Maytag Bravo series washer error code 5d

This error code indicates excessive detergent suds occurred during the cycle. This could be caused by using too much detergent or not using High Efficiency (HE) detergent. The washer will not be able to spin out water with the excess suds.

Can i use dry detergent in my F&P model GWL11 washing machine. my husband and i have a bet on this answer

If this is a high efficiency washer you can use an HE dry detergent or an HE lignin detergent or the new pod detergents. Do not use non HE detergent in an HE machine. The difference is the amount t of suds that the detergent makes. If it is not an HE washer you can use whatever detergent you like HE or non HE. Many front load units have a adapter that you use when using dry vs. Liquid detergents.

MHW6000XW LIST OF ERROR CODES AND WHAT THEY MEAN

F20 water only problem insufficient water supply open both hot and cold unclog hoses
F21 Drain problem clogged,frozen kinked
SUD excess sud using non he detergent or to much detergent
F22 front door lock door not closed properly
For these select poepwer/cancel twice to cancel cycle
Other f codes select power/cancel twice select drain& spin if youhave excess water

Will using a non HE detergent ruin the drum bearings and/or cause corrosion?? my repairman said that my regular detergent (free and clear) ruined my machine (kenmore model 417....)

High Efficiency detergents are supposed to have a different formulation in order to reduce foaming. Over foaming in a front-loader will reduce the cleaning action (flop & drop) within the drum, and reduce the rinse efficiency.

SO usage of non HE can reduce the efficiency and the bearing are tend to be worn out...

Washer won't spin & drain, "dc" showing

Hello Nancy, this is what I've retrieved right from Samsung. "dc" on those washer's mean this, In the words of ( Samsung ) the manufacturer..."Unbalance or cabinet bump is detected during final spin which prevents it from spinning over 400rpm". ( Never exceeds 400rpm due to unbalanced load ). Then they (Samsung) say, " not enough load. Put additional items to equal load" or "excessive suds from too much detergent or wrong type/non-high-efficiency, use less or switch to high-efficiency ("HE"). I would check for too many suds from either too much "HE" or you're using the wrong stuff...regular detergent/non-"HE" let me know if I can assist you further and thanks for coming to "fixya" today.
